Subject: Handover — Ledgerfin export memory fix

Mira,

Handing off the Ledgerfin 5.3 release. The spreadsheet export path no longer buffers whole workbooks in memory; we stream rows now, peak usage dropped roughly 80%. No new dependencies, nothing network-facing changed. Artifacts are built and signed on the isolated runner as usual. For your records, the deploy key in use is below.

deploy key for yajop-fahop: bky3_h1v

Restricted: managers only. Status of second-source search for the Orvane valve assembly. Current sole supplier is Teller & Frask. Three candidates shortlisted: Bryce Foundry, Almont Precision, and Wexhall Components. Sample parts due end of month; qualification testing runs six weeks. Budget impact estimated as neutral in year one. Selection rationale connects to the plan noted below.

board note of kagep-yahig: Only 9 of the 120 pilot accounts renewed Quenix, so a churn review is set for April 1.

## 3.2.0 — Default changes

The Parcelwyn tracking webhook now retries failed deliveries with exponential backoff capped at six attempts, replacing the previous fixed five-second retry. Signature verification is mandatory: unsigned payloads are dropped rather than logged-and-accepted. The delivery timeout was reduced from 30 to 10 seconds to prevent slow consumers from stalling the dispatch pool. Reviewers should confirm the new defaults, reproduced below.

service settings:
HOLDOR_PIN=6477
HOLDOR_METRICS_HOST=metrics.holdor.nelvrocorp.corp
HOLDOR_LOG_LEVEL=error
HOLDOR_TENANT=noviel

Action item from the Wrenfield outage review: the offline queue in the SurveyPath field app retried uploads too aggressively once towers came back, saturating the ingest tier and dropping 14% of submissions. We agreed to codify the retry and batching behavior as explicit, documented constants rather than inline literals, so future changes are deliberate and reviewable. Any edit to these values must be accompanied by a replay test against the Marlow Basin capture set. The agreed constants are recorded below.

tuning constants:
BUDGETS = {
    "druath": 240,
    "lamwyn": 180,
    "silael": 275,
}